style="display:inline-block;width:728px;height:90px"
data-ad-client="ca-pub-5164839828746352"
data-ad-slot="7563230308">

blog de chicowed

Fundamentos de Programación

Al hablar de fundamentos de programación nos referimos a aquellos conocimientos básicos que nos permitirán desenvolvernos sin excesivo número de tropiezos. Veamos a qué tipo de tropiezos nos referimos utilizando un símil de transporte. El conductor (programador) dispone de un coche (el ordenador) y desea trasladarse entre dos puntos de una ciudad (objetivo del programa). Como es lógico existen unos criterios en la búsqueda del objetivo como hacerlo en el menor tiempo posible (ahorrar tiempo de programación), ir por las calles o autovías más cómodas (un programa sencillo y comprensible) y economizar combustible, neumáticos, etc. (ahorrar memoria y evitar procesos innecesarios que ocupen recursos de nuestro ordenador). Si nuestro hipotético conductor no tiene ningún tipo de conocimiento ¿qué fundamentos habría que darle para cumplir el objetivo?

Error MySQL "too many connections"

Buen día compañeros, traigo la siguiente inquietud espero me puedan orientar,
anteriormente para hacer una conexion a mysql lo hacia de la siguiente manera, creaba una clase conexion, compuesta de la siguiente manera

package Logica;

import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;
import javax.swing.JOptionPane;

/**
 *
 * @author CARLOS
 */

public class conexion {
    public String db="basereserva";
    public String url="jdbc:mysql://localhost/" +db;
    public String user="root";
    public String pass="digito";

    public conexion() {
    }
   
    public Connection conectar(){
        Connection link=null;
       
        try {
            Class.forName("org.gjt.mm.mysql.Driver");
            link=DriverManager.getConnection(this.url, this.user, this.pass);
           
        } catch (ClassNotFoundException | SQLException e) {
            JOptionPane.showConfirmDialog(null, e);
           
        }
       
        return link;
    }
}

Pero esto me trajo con sigo un error "to many connections"

Ayuda Formulario Login

Buen día compañeros el motivo de mi entrada es la siguiente, espero alguien pueda apoyarme.

tengo un formulario login tipico, pide usuario, contraseña un boton para entrar y uno para salir.

en mi clase tengo un metodo llamado acceder que es el siguiente.

void acceder(String usuario, String pass) {
        String usu = "";
        String pas = "";

        String sql = "SELECT * FROM usuario WHERE usuario='" + usuario + "' && password='" + pass + "'";
        try {
            Statement st = cn.createStatement();
            ResultSet rs = st.executeQuery(sql);
            while (rs.next()) {
                usu = rs.getString("usuario");
                pas = rs.getString("password");
            }

            if (usu.equals(usuario) && pas.equals(pass)) {
                this.setVisible(false);
                InterfacePrincipal principal = new InterfacePrincipal();
                principal.setVisible(true);
            } else {
                JOptionPane.showMessageDialog(null, "Usuario y/o Contraseña no Validos");
            }
        } catch (SQLException ex) {

Desktop Pane

Que tal compañeros buen día, tengo un problema y es el siguiente.
estoy haciendo una pequeña aplicacion MDI, y quisiera personalizar el Desktop Pane que viene por defecto, la pregunta es como agregarle una imagen de fondo.
Gracias.

Conexion Remota a MySQL

Hola compañeros buen día traigo el siguiente problemita espero me puedan echar la mano.

Tengo un programa que trabaja con bases de datos MySQL, siempre había trabajado de manera local, y no habia tenido ningun problema, ahora me toco tener que trabajar de manera remota, tengo una Red Local, con una maquina servidor, que es la que tiene instalado el MySQL, todos los equipos incluyendo el servidor tiene una IP fija, ya edite los archivos de configuracion para que me permita conexiones remotas, cuando abro un navegador en una maquina cliente y pongo la IP del servidor 192.3.5.240/phpmyadmin, me abre la pagina principal del phpmyadmin, hasta este punto no tengo problemas, el problema lo tengo cuando ejecuto mi aplicación en una maquina cliente, me manda la siguiente excepción:
java.sql.SQLException: null, message from server: "Host '192.3.5.24' is not allowed to connect to this MySQL server"
la IP 192.3.5.24 es la IP de la maquina cliente de la que me quiero conectar.
Yo utilizo el wampserver.

Si alguien ha tenido este mismo problema y lo ha solucionado le agredeceria infinitamente la ayuda, esto me esta volviendo loco.

Compilar aplicaciones de 64 y 32 bits

Disculpen la ignorancia, tengo un pequeño problemita si compilo una aplicación java en un sistema de 64 bits y lo quiero correrer en un sistema de 32. Correra?, se que java se puede correr en cualquier SO siempre y cuando tenga la maquina virtual java instalada, pero que hay de la arquitectura del sistema.
Gracias de antemano.

Como mandar a llamar una funcion cada cierto tiempo.

Hola compañeros buen día, quisiera saber como mandar a llamar a una función en java cada cierto tiempo,
por ejemplo:

que la función

 void hola_mundo() {

                    System.out.println("Hola Mundo");
}

Se mande a llamar cada segundo por ejemplo.
De antemano muchas gracias.

Como obtener la fecha y hora actual en un JSpinner.

Hola a todos, tengo el siguiente problemita disculpen la ignoracia soy nuevo en java, quisiera saber como obtener la hora y fecha del sistema y colocar esos datos en un JSpinner, algun ejemplo, o alguna referencia para ponerme a estudiar, he leido que necesito usar una libreria de tiempo, si alguien me puede auxiliar se lo agradeceria mucho...

Distribuir contenido

style="display:inline-block;width:728px;height:90px"
data-ad-client="ca-pub-5164839828746352"
data-ad-slot="7563230308">